**The Role**
As our resident Payroll & Benefits Advisor, you will be accountable for the best practice delivery of payroll and benefits operations within KBR’s People & Culture Operations team. You will drive superior outcomes for our business and our people.
With support from the People & Culture Operations team and our onshore and offshore Finance teams, you will be responsible for payroll for KBR Australia. You will manage all pre-payroll activities, provide payroll advice, and have a strong involvement in the implementation of new FinOps and payroll systems. As part of this role, you will be expected to develop close working relationships with key internal stakeholders, including Tax, Finance, and People & Culture, as well as any key external stakeholders/vendors.
The key responsibilities of the role will include, but is not limited to:
- Manage all pre-payroll administrative activities for fortnightly and monthly pay cycles
- Calculation and processing of termination payments, redundancies, back payments, overpayments, superannuation lodgments etc.
- Support the coordination and implementation of all employee benefits
- Coordinate process improvements within payroll to ensure duplications are minimised and demands on systems and/or resources are reduced
- Develop & maintain relationships with key stakeholders (People & Culture, Finance, Tax, Lines of Business, and external vendors) providing high levels of customer service
- Provide advice to the business on payroll queries and various payroll issues that may arise
- Keep the People & Culture team and wider business up to date on key legislative changes and the impact this will have on their business
**Required Qualifications, Experience and Knowledge**
- A minimum of 3 years’ experience in a payroll role
- Excellent communication skills in a range of situations both written and oral
- A strategic and commercial awareness of payroll impacts
- An enthusiastic and flexible attitude to work
- The ability to be a strong and motivated team player
- The ability to work under pressure and meet tight deadlines
- Project management skills with the ability to plan and prioritize work, and meet deadlines
- Previous experience in a stand-alone Payroll Advisor position is desirable
- Previous experience with SAP, Microsoft Dynamics and/or Workday is desirable
